I would never go so far as to say there’s no place for AI in music (I’m a fan of Holly Herndon, after all). But I generally find music made with generative AI to be offensively boring, especially the outputs of Suno. So I’m having a bit of a tough time processing the fact that I actually quite enjoy 1010Benja’s “Semiramis’ Dream.”

Benja has been unapologetic about his use of generative AI on his latest EP, Time Has Nothing To Do With What You Choose… The other three tracks can’t quite hold a candle to what you find on 2024’s Ten Total.
